Transaction 6298810940e9e23966d44f7b223fbc5566641f74a061af46984358b0b6346795
2 Input
2 Outputs
- 6298810940e9e23966d44f7b223fbc5566641f74a061af46984358b0b6346795:0
- 6298810940e9e23966d44f7b223fbc5566641f74a061af46984358b0b6346795:1
value 100000
address 1aNpPqA61En4NDXM434AE5dWM5LXQFG5k
value 9953
address 1GbSjvYyZMx4B2rtgUETRFkQZbZ7c37ym3